But What Is A Code Reader For Cars, and how can it help you understand and address vehicle issues?
A car code reader, also known as an OBD2 scanner or diagnostic scanner, is a tool designed to communicate with your car’s On-Board Diagnostics system, or OBD. Since the 1990s, OBD systems have been standard in most vehicles, monitoring various aspects of your car’s engine and emissions systems. When your car detects a problem, it generates a Diagnostic Trouble Code (DTC) and often illuminates the “check engine light” or a similar warning indicator on your dashboard. This is where a code reader becomes invaluable.
Decoding Your Car’s Language: Understanding OBD2 and DTCs
To understand what a code reader for cars does, it’s essential to grasp the basics of OBD2. OBD-II is the standardized system used in most cars today. It’s essentially your car’s internal reporting system, constantly monitoring sensors and systems. When something goes wrong, the OBD-II system logs a DTC – a standardized alphanumeric code that pinpoints the area of the problem.
Think of DTCs as your car’s way of telling you specifically what’s amiss. These codes aren’t always straightforward, but a code reader acts as a translator, pulling these codes from your car’s computer and displaying them in a way you can understand. Many code readers also provide descriptions of what each code means, giving you a crucial first step in diagnosing car problems.
The Benefits of Using a Car Code Reader
Why should you consider using a car code reader? The advantages are numerous for car owners of all levels of mechanical expertise:
- Early Problem Detection: A code reader allows you to identify potential issues early on, sometimes even before symptoms become obvious. Addressing problems early can prevent more significant and costly repairs down the road.
- DIY Diagnostics and Saving Money: Instead of immediately rushing to a mechanic for every check engine light, a code reader empowers you to perform initial diagnostics yourself. Knowing the fault code can give you a better understanding of the problem and help you decide if it’s something you can fix yourself or if professional help is needed. This can save you money on unnecessary diagnostic fees.
- Informed Discussions with Mechanics: Even if you prefer to have a professional handle repairs, knowing the DTC beforehand allows for more informed conversations with mechanics. You’ll be able to discuss the specific issue and ensure you’re getting the right service.
- Performance Monitoring: Beyond just reading fault codes, many modern code readers can display real-time data from your car’s sensors. This can include engine temperature, RPM, speed, and more. This live data can be useful for monitoring your car’s performance and identifying trends.
- Resetting the Check Engine Light: Once a problem is resolved, a code reader can often be used to reset the check engine light. This is important because a lit check engine light might mask new issues that arise later.
Key Features to Look For in a Car Code Reader
When choosing a code reader, consider the features that best suit your needs:
- Fault Code Reading and Resetting: This is the core function of any code reader. Ensure it can read and clear DTCs effectively.
- DTC Definitions: A helpful code reader will provide descriptions of the fault codes it reads, either built-in or through a connected app.
- Live Data Streaming: The ability to view real-time sensor data is a valuable feature for performance monitoring and more in-depth diagnostics.
- Freeze Frame Data: This feature captures sensor readings at the moment a fault code was triggered, providing a snapshot of the conditions when the problem occurred.
- Advanced Tests (Mode 06, Readiness Tests): More advanced readers may offer features like Mode 06 testing (ECU self-monitoring results) and emissions readiness tests, which are useful for confirming repairs and preparing for vehicle inspections.
- Vehicle Compatibility: Ensure the code reader is compatible with your car’s make and model. Most OBD2 readers are universally compatible with vehicles manufactured after 1996, but it’s always best to double-check.
- Ease of Use: Look for a code reader with an intuitive interface, whether it’s a standalone device or an app-based system.
Choosing the Right Code Reader: From Basic to Advanced
The market offers a wide range of code readers, from basic handheld devices to sophisticated smartphone-based systems. Basic code readers are affordable and great for simple fault code reading and clearing. More advanced options, especially app-based scanners used with OBD2 adapters, offer enhanced features like live data, advanced tests, and vehicle-specific diagnostics.
